Age
African Greys can become bored and lonely if they do not have enough contact with humans. This could lead to feather plucking, chomping and other behavioral issues. They require a stable and stable environment to thrive. They require regular training sessions and time spent with their loved ones, as well as daily enrichment activities like foraging, problem-solving, and chewing exercises. This keeps their minds active and make them feel like a part of the family.
It is an excellent idea to think about buying an adult bird instead of one that is a baby because they are generally more content and will be a strong bond with their new owners. If you're going to buy an adult bird, it is essential that you are aware of the extent to which your lifestyle will accommodate an animal before making the purchase. If you're not sure you should consider volunteering at a rescue center to assist the birds. This will provide you with an understanding of these fascinating animals.
Another thing to think about is the cost of maintaining the health of an African Grey on a monthly basis. They are not as costly as cats or dogs however, they do require attention, fed and kept healthy. It is recommended that you purchase exotic pet insurance to cover veterinary expenses.
Parrots are a long-lived species that can live for up to 50 years. They deserve to have an enjoyable and fulfilled life in the company of their family. It is best not to buy a bird if are unable to commit to it for the remainder of its life. Adopt a bird who needs to be relocated due to many reasons, such as divorce, illness, relocation, and loss of a pet. This is more humane for the bird because it stops them from having to be constantly re-homed and rejected due to changes in circumstances, which can be extremely stressful for these intelligent birds.
Health
African Grey Parrots rank among the most intelligent birds in the world. They can spell, count, and speak at a level similar to a child of four years old. They are also extremely compassionate creatures. These characteristics make them great companions for people of any age.
They are a popular choice among bird-lovers, and are often regarded as the best birds to begin with. However, African greys can be difficult for new owners due to their complexity and sensitive nature. They require experienced owners to take care of them appropriately. If they are not properly cared for, they can become stressed and display behavioral problems such as chewing or plucking feathers.
You should also think about the cost of caring for your pet. You will also require toys and accessories along with a large cage to accommodate the bird. A typical cage for an African gray bird can cost between $250-$500. You'll also need to purchase a premium food for your pet. African greys are omnivores and love eating vegetables, fruits and grains. They also require you to give them plenty of water.
Another aspect to be considered is the expense of vet visits. The vet visit is crucial to ensure the health of your bird. The majority of exotic vets charge between $100 and $250 per appointment. You'll also require pet insurance for your african gray. Typically, insurance for pets for these birds costs between $20 and $40 a month.
Last but not least, you'll need to consider the cost of travel and holidays. African greys require regular human interaction, and prolonged periods of time outside of the cage. They are usually one member of the family and will miss them greatly when they are not present. It is essential to have a bird sitter on hand in case you are away.
If you're not willing to invest a significant amount of time in your african grey parrots on sale grey, it is unlikely that will be able to care for the bird in a proper manner. Parrots can be very noisy and could cause frustration for you if you cannot take their noise. It is crucial to consider if you are able to live with a loud animal prior to buying an african gray.
